ABSTRACT:
A room-temperature-curable silicone elastomer composition that is highly workable prior to its cure and that cures to give a silicone elastomer having a desirable stiffness is made from a silanol-terminated polydiorganosiloxane, a dialkoxysiloxane of the formula ##STR1## where R.sup.1 represents monovalent hydrocarbon groups and R.sup.2 represents monovalent hydrocarbon groups having 1 to 8 carbon atoms, a tri- or tetra-alkoxysilane, and a curing catalyst.
